


Thicker materials should be tested using ASTM D638. ASTM D882 can be used for testing materials thinner than 1mm in thickness. The samples are tested in specific conditions of pre-treatment, sample orientation, temperature, humidity, and rate of pulling. Cut samples need to be free of nicks and other cutting defects since they will have an important impact on the test results variation. No dumbbell shape is cut for materials of that thickness. The samples are cut in strips that minimally have to be eight times longer than wide. ASTM D882 is used to measure tensile properties including ultimate tensile strength, yield strength, elongation, tensile energy to break and tensile modulus of elasticity of thin plastic sheeting and films. The ASTM D882 tests the tensile properties of thin plastic sheeting.
